Toy Story 5 Box Office Collection Data: The Film Amasses A STELLAR Number!

Toy Story 5 has officially cemented itself as a massive financial triumph for Disney and Pixar, currently boasting a phenomenal worldwide gross of $764,348,690.

According to the latest reporting, the animated feature has generated $366,348,690 domestically, which accounts for 47.9% of its total revenue. Internationally, the film has secured $398,000,000, representing the remaining 52.1% of its global earnings.

This stellar Toy Story 5 Box Office Collection Data confirms that the thirty-year-old franchise remains a dominant commercial force. The film successfully cleared its massive $250,000,000 production budget almost immediately, driven by a record-breaking opening weekend.

By effectively capturing multi-generational nostalgia and delivering critically acclaimed animation, the movie is mathematically on track to join the billion-dollar club before concluding its theatrical run.

The Opening Weekend Dominance

Shattering Domestic Records

The financial momentum of the film was entirely established during its massive debut. In North America alone, the movie secured $160,000,000 during its opening weekend, giving it the second-best domestic opening for an animated film in history. This staggering figure completely surpassed the debuts of all four previous franchise installments, explicitly proving that audiences remain deeply invested in the ongoing adventures of Woody and Buzz Lightyear.

The Global Theatrical Impact

Internationally, the film debuted to an equally impressive $152,000,000, resulting in a cumulative global opening weekend of $312,000,000. This definitively marks the largest global opening for any movie released in 2026 so far, cementing its immediate worldwide dominance.

Key international markets such as Mexico ($48,000,000), the United Kingdom ($37,800,000), and China ($29,800,000) heavily contributed to this explosive overseas performance during the initial launch window.

Production Budget and Profitability

Massive Returns on Investment

The studio allocated a massive $250,000,000 production budget to ensure the digital animation met the highest possible visual standards. Thanks to its explosive opening weekend, the film completely cleared its production costs almost instantly, significantly accelerating its path to pure profitability.

Financial analysts at The Numbers note that the current worldwide gross is already 3.1 times the original production budget, ensuring a massive return on investment for the studio.

Comparative Data Table: The Pixar Opening Hierarchy

To fully contextualize the massive scale of this achievement, here is a definitive comparative data table analyzing the highest domestic opening weekends in Pixar Animation Studios history:

RankFilm TitleDomestic Opening Weekend
1Incredibles 2 (2018)$183,600,000
2Toy Story 5 (2026)$160,000,000
3Inside Out 2 (2024)$154,200,000
4Finding Dory (2016)$135,000,000
5Toy Story 4 (2019)$120,900,000

Critical Reception and Audience Retention

Exceptional Audience Grading

The sustained box office momentum is heavily supported by exceptional word-of-mouth and universal critical acclaim. Opening weekend audiences polled by CinemaScore awarded the picture a perfect “A” grade, aligning it perfectly with the high standards of the franchise. Additionally, the film currently holds a highly coveted 94% Certified Fresh rating from critics on Rotten Tomatoes, while general audiences assigned it a 95% Verified Hot approval score.
